SN65HVD1471: SN65HVD1471D Support Half-Duplex RS-485 Communication

Part Number: SN65HVD1471

Tool/software:

Hi

We are using the SN65HVD1471D in an RS-485 bus where we intend to operate it in half-duplex mode (same differential pair for TX and RX). We have externally shorted the Y to A and Z to B to create a shared bus line.

We are able to transmit data successfully, but no data is received at the R pin. We suspect the lack of DE/RE pins prevents proper driver disable during reception.

Could you confirm whether SN65HVD1471D supports half-duplex operation in this manner?

  • Hi Dimple,

    If you are trying to switch from driver to receiver, it won't work since the driver will always be active without the DE/RE pins to disable the driver when it wants to receive signals. 

    If you need to support a half duplex mode, you'll need to respin the board with a different device with the DE/RE pins.
